The video discusses the critical role of the £20 uplift in Universal Credit for families during the pandemic, emphasizing the need to maintain it. It highlights the importance of a successful COVID-19 vaccination rollout across the UK, urging unity. The challenges faced by the fishing industry due to Brexit are addressed, criticizing the government's lack of preparation. The Labour Party's focus on future elections and its determination to return to government are also discussed.
